This is my card for the Alphabet challenge letter T for tea bag art. I used the most recent sketch challenge and color challenge to create my tea bag art card though I don't have Terracotta Tile so substituted Calypso Coral.
I stamped my tea cup first, masked it, and then stamped the tea kettle. I colored it with SU markers.
Next I cut my Cherry Cobbler panel and repeatedly stamped the Take a Sip Wheel using Cherry Cobbler for some tone on tone texture.
I don't have any So Saffron cs so went direct to paper with the ink pad to create my corner. Cut it off, stamped the sentiment, and assembled the card.
